Virtual Reality in Education: Unlocking New Learning Opportunities
Virtual reality (VR) is rapidly revolutionizing the educational landscape, creating immersive learning environments that enhance student engagement and comprehension. This technology offers a unique way to present complex subjects, allowing students to experience lessons in a rich, interactive format. The following explores how virtual reality in education is unlocking new learning opportunities across various disciplines.
One of the most significant advantages of VR in education is its ability to create immersive simulations. For example, students studying biology can explore the human body in 3D, allowing them to visualize anatomy and physiological processes that would be challenging to grasp through traditional textbooks alone. This hands-on experience not only enhances understanding but also fosters a deeper interest in the subject matter.
In addition to science, virtual reality is transforming language learning. With VR, students can practice conversational skills in simulated real-world environments. Programs that immerse learners in a virtual city where they must communicate with native speakers can significantly enhance language acquisition. This experiential learning method helps students build confidence and fluency far more effectively than conventional classroom practices.
History classes also benefit from VR technology. Students can take virtual field trips to historical sites, experiencing significant events in a more engaging manner. Imagine walking through ancient Rome or witnessing the signing of the Declaration of Independence. Such experiences make learning about history more relatable and impactful, helping students to connect emotionally with the material.
In vocational training, VR is proving invaluable by providing safe environments to practice skills. For trades like carpentry, plumbing, or electrical work, students can engage in hands-on experiences without the risks associated with real-world practice. This approach not only promotes safety but also allows for repeated practice — a fundamental aspect of skill acquisition.
Additionally, VR is breaking down geographical barriers in education. Students in remote or underserved areas can access high-quality learning resources through virtual classrooms, engaging with expert educators from around the world. This democratization of education helps to level the playing field, ensuring that every student has access to the same high standards of learning.
Moreover, the integration of VR in education promotes collaboration. Virtual environments enable students to work together on projects, regardless of their physical location. This collaboration nurtures teamwork, communication skills, and problem-solving abilities, which are essential in today's global workforce.
As educators look toward the future, it's essential to consider the challenges associated with implementing VR technology. These may include the cost of equipment, the need for teacher training, and the integration of VR into existing curricula. However, the long-term benefits of fostering an engaging and effective learning environment make the investment worthwhile.
